Discovering More About AC/DC’s Origins

Did you know that AC/DC was formed in 1973 by brothers Malcolm and Angus Young in Sydney? They started with a shared vision of hard rock that would shake the ground beneath their feet. The band’s name comes from a sewing machine’s power supply, signifying “alternating current/direct current,” which hints at their electrifying sound. Talk about an electrifying origin story! Plus, their iconic logo, featuring the bold lightning bolt, quickly became a symbol of rock ‘n’ roll rebellion. Unforgettable Albums and Hits

Now, let’s dive into the music. AC/DC has released some of the most unforgettable albums in rock history. Their 1980 release, Back in Black, remains the second-best-selling album of all time, right after Michael Jackson’s Thriller! It’s hard to believe that it was recorded after the tragic loss of vocalist Bon Scott. But the addition of Brian Johnson marked a turning point, leading to hits like “Hells Bells” and “Shoot to Thrill,” which still get cranked up on radios and playlists worldwide. Not to mention, did you ever wonder about their signature sound? It stems from Angus’s wild guitar riffs complemented by driving rhythms, which have inspired countless bands over the years.

Tales of Live Performances

And who could forget AC/DC’s explosive live shows? They’re known for their high-energy performances, with Angus often donning his signature schoolboy outfit while belting out guitar solos that leave fans breathless. The band’s knack for raw stage energy made them legends long before modern rock’s glitzy performances took over. One memorable instance was the “Let There Be Rock” concert film released in 1980, showcasing their electrifying rawness on stage and further cementing their legacy.
